One dead in 141 crash in Marinette Co.
According to a Marinette County Sheriff's Office news release, it happened when the driver of a blue pickup truck traveling northbound on 141 near Jossart Road, crossed the center line, colliding with both a sedan and a pickup truck in the southbound lane.
UPDATE: One dead, one injured in three car crash
The 81 year old man killed in a Marinette County three car crash Friday has been identified as Carl J. Bernetzke of Green Bay Wisconsin.
The driver of the pickup truck that went left of center and struck the Bernetzke vehicle was driven by Leroy D. Poglud of Goodman, Wisconsin.
Poglud then impacted a third vehicle driven by Donald E. Britten Jr. of Langlade County, Wisconsin.
The crash remains under investigation by the Marinette County Sheriff's Office and Coroner.
